If the shoots are browsed even once during the growing season, they are ruined for weaving, so either train them high or fence the patch in if browsing animals will be present. The plants are cut down every year (known as coppicing), typically low down, either right at ground level, or a foot to 18 inches high. Coppicing (cutting) each plant in the dormant winter season is key to producing a productive plant with lots of straight stems so that the willow will regenerate with more rods each year. You need a lot of plants to get enough rods to weave with, so I would plan for at least 25 plants in the end but they are planted very close together.
